1. Decompose factor A ^ 4-3a ^ 2 + 2 in the range of real number 2. Try to prove: no matter m takes any real value, the value of the algebraic formula 3M ^ 2 + 4m + 5 is always greater than zero

First question
a^4-3a^2+2=(a^2-1)(a^2-2)
Second question
3m^2+4m+5
=3(m^2+4/3 m)+5
=3(m^2+4/3 m+4/9)-4/3+5
=3(m+2/3)^2 +11/3
>0
So no matter m takes any real value, the value of the algebraic formula 3M ^ 2 + 4m + 5 is always greater than zero
